What is the first John Deere tractor?
After years of testing, John Deere released its first proper diesel tractor in 1949, the Model R. The R was also the first Deere tractor with a ‘live’ independent PTO equipped with its own clutch. The R also incorporated live hydraulics.

Who made John Deere tractors?
Dain All-Wheel Drive. The Dain All-Wheel Drive was the first tractor produced by John Deere and had only a single rear wheel. In 1911, Deere purchased the Dain Manufacturing Company of Ottumwa , Iowa. The next year, Deere decided to design its own tractor, and Dain founder Joseph Dain Sr., was directed to design that tractor.

What size is a John Deere tractor?
John Deere WA-14 Tractor Dimensions. It is 257 inches (652 cm) long, 104 inches (264 cm) wide and 99 inches (251 cm) high. The cab height is 130 inches (330 cm) and the ground clearance is 19 inches (48 cm). The tires of the John Deere WA-14 are Ag front: 23.1-30, Ag rear: 23.1-30, Ag front: 18.4-34 and Ag rear: 18.4-34.

How does the John Deere old steel plow work?
The steel plow was invented by John Deere in 1837 in Grand Detour, Illinois, when he took a broken blade from a sawmill and used it as a plow to break up the soil. Because of the steel, the soil did not stick to the blade, and Deere was able to plow with new efficiency, leading to enhanced productivity.
